What is the Opportunity? In this role you will be responsible for providing financial decision support to Insurance and Finance business partners by presenting financial analysis and reporting requirements. You will contribute to the monthly and quarterly reporting for Insurance Finance. The successful candidate acts as the key point of contact for financial reporting and analysis within their portfolio and manages multiple deliverables while engaging with teams across Finance and Insurance.

Responsibilities
  • Prepare monthly financial advisory packages for the Insurance senior management team and Performance Management, focusing on business drivers and highlighting opportunities and risks to long‑term business objectives.
  • Facilitate the forecast, planning & analysis (FP&A) process for Insurance, including periodic forecasts, annual planning and 5‑year planning.
  • Prepare and review financial statement notes in accordance with IFRS and RBC reporting standards.
  • Apply business and application knowledge to facilitate problem analysis across the financial reporting applications, identifying solutions and developing creative options aligned with business strategies and tactics.
  • Coordinate financial information for executive presentations.
  • Fulfill the needs of senior management for a variety of constant ad‑hoc reports relating to actual, forecast and plan, including strategic initiatives.
  • Work with other members of the Reporting and Forecasting team to streamline and improve the timeliness and accuracy of consolidated RBC Insurance reporting processes, including use of new technology.
  • Work closely with business partners to proactively develop and consistently improve upon the information needed to support the management of the RBC Insurance business.
